Converting between Fahrenheit and Celsius

The formulas are given, so nothing is memorised. What the question tests is whether you pick the right one and handle a negative value without losing a sign.

\(C = \tfrac{5}{9}(F - 32)\) going TO Celsius: subtract first
\(F = \tfrac{9}{5}C + 32\) going TO Fahrenheit: multiply first
Both are printed on the screen, so the only decision is which. Pick by the unit you are heading to: the formula that starts “C =” gives you Celsius. Then follow the order of operations exactly — the bracket comes before the fraction.
Common slips
(1) Used the wrong formula. Check which side of the equals sign your target unit is on. (2) Lost a sign. −4.2 − 32 is −36.2, not −28.2 or 27.8. A negative reading minus a positive number goes further negative. (3) Multiplied before subtracting. The bracket is not decoration.
